[Pre-emptive kidney transplant].

E Morales Ruiz1

  • 1Hospital 12 de Octubre, Madrid.

Nefrologia : Publicacion Oficial De La Sociedad Espanola Nefrologia
|November 21, 2008
PubMed
Summary
This summary is machine-generated.

Early kidney transplantation significantly improves survival and quality of life for end-stage kidney disease patients compared to dialysis. Prioritizing early transplant avoids dialysis burdens and offers better long-term outcomes.

Area of Science:

  • Nephrology
  • Transplantation Surgery
  • Public Health

Context:

  • End-stage kidney disease (ESKD) necessitates renal replacement therapy.
  • Dialysis is a common treatment but associated with poorer prognosis.
  • Kidney transplantation offers superior outcomes for ESKD patients.

Purpose:

  • To evaluate the benefits of early kidney transplantation versus dialysis.
  • To identify optimal timing for kidney transplant listing.
  • To advocate for strategies addressing organ shortages.

Summary:

  • Early kidney transplant improves graft and patient survival compared to dialysis.
  • Transplant should be considered for all eligible patients, including those over 65.
  • Optimal listing occurs when glomerular filtration rate is <15-20 ml/min, anticipating dialysis within 1-2 years.

Impact:

  • Early transplantation enhances patient quality of life and survival.
  • Promoting organ donation and utilizing diverse donor sources is crucial.
  • Shifting focus towards pre-dialysis transplantation is scientifically supported.
